Challenges in Industrial Water Filtration

Preventing Contaminants Entering Your Process Water Systems

Water used in industrial processes can introduce particulates, debris, and organic contaminants that impact production efficiency and equipment performance. Whether sourced from mains supply, boreholes, or recycled systems, untreated water can lead to fouling, scaling, and premature wear if not properly filtered at the point of entry.

Protecting Municipal Water Treatment from Incoming Contamination

Raw water entering municipal treatment works often contains suspended solids, organic matter, and environmental contaminants that vary depending on the source. Effective pre-filtration is essential to stabilise treatment processes, reduce load on downstream systems, and ensure consistent water quality throughout the treatment cycle.

Building Services Sysyems at Point of Entry 

Water entering commercial and residential buildings can carry sediment, rust, and pipework debris from the mains supply. Without adequate filtration, these contaminants can accumulate within systems, leading to blockages, equipment damage, and reduced efficiency across HVAC, heating, and potable water systems.

Water Filtration Resources and Support

What causes fouling in water filtration systems?

Fouling is typically caused by a build-up of suspended solids, organics, or biological matter within the system. Implementing effective pre-filtration with depth filters or bag filters, alongside carbon filtration where required, helps reduce fouling and maintain consistent system performance.

How can filtration extend the life of water treatment equipment?

Unfiltered water can introduce abrasive particles and contaminants that accelerate wear on pumps, valves, and membranes. Installing cartridge filters, strainers, and staged filtration systems helps protect critical equipment and reduces maintenance and replacement costs.

What is the best way to remove turbidity from water?

Turbidity is caused by suspended particles that affect water clarity and quality. A combination of coarse filtration and fine depth cartridge filters is commonly used to progressively remove particles and achieve the desired level of clarity.

How do I prevent blockages in water systems and pipework?

Blockages are often the result of accumulated debris, scale, or particulate matter entering the system. Using mesh strainers, bag filters, and pre-filtration units at key entry points helps capture contaminants early and maintain unrestricted flow.

What filtration is used to protect reverse osmosis systems?

Reverse osmosis systems are highly sensitive to particulates and chlorine, both of which can damage membranes. Effective protection typically includes depth cartridge filters for particulate removal and activated carbon filters to eliminate chlorine and organic compounds before the RO stage.

Clean-In-Place (CIP) and Sterilise-In-Place (SIP) systems are critical to maintaining hygiene, product safety, and regulatory compliance in food, beverage, dairy, and pharmaceutical processing.

CIP enables the cleaning of pipelines, vesselSteams, filters, and process equipment without dismantling, using controlled cycles of detergents, temperature, and flow to remove product residues, biofilms, and contaminants.

SIP follows with high-temperature steam sterilisation to eliminate microorganisms and ensure systems are safe for production.

Effective CIP/SIP design ensures:

  • Reliable microbial control
  • Reduced downtime and manual intervention
  • Protection of filtration systems and membranes
  • Consistent product quality and audit readiness

When properly engineered, CIP and SIP are not just cleaning steps they are integral to process performance and operational efficiency.

What Is Utility Filtration?                    Municipal RO system

Utility filtration refers to filtration systems designed to clean and condition fluids used in support roles across manufacturing and processing environments rather than final product filtration. These include:


Utility fluids such as compressed air, steam, water and process gases are essential to industrial operations. Their quality directly affects product safety, equipment performance and regulatory compliance. Advanced utility filtration ensures contaminants are removed before they can compromise products or damage critical assets.

Effective utility filtration prevents contamination, improves product consistency, reduces maintenance costs, and supports regulatory compliance.
